If you are in the funeral industry, you may be familiar with the term “cremulator.” But for those who are not, a cremulator is a machine used to process human remains after cremation. It is essentially a grinder that reduces the bone fragments left after cremation into a fine powder, known as cremains. These cremains are then given to the family of the deceased as a final tribute.
